Abstract

On September 1, 2021, the Agricultural Marketing Service (AMS) amended the provisions of the Milk Donation Reimbursement Program through September 1, 2023, and added regulations for the Dairy Donation Program, on an interim basis, set to expire September 1, 2023. On August 24, 2023, AMS published a final rule further amending the provisions of both programs and removing the expiration date for the Dairy Donation Program. However, we failed to formally adopt the interim provisions, remove the expiration of the amendments to the Milk Donation Reimbursement Program, and list the removal of both expirations in the DATES section of the preamble. This final rule corrects that oversight.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: The Dairy Donations Program (DDP) was 
implemented on September 1, 2021, through an interim final rule (86 FR 
48887). The final rule of August 25, 2023 (88 FR 57861), finalized and 
made minor changes to the provisions of the DDP codified at 7 CFR part 
1147. The final rule of August 25, 2023, also further amended the 
provisions of the Milk Donation Reimbursement Program (MDRP), which was 
established in 2021 (84 FR 46658), and amended in 2021 (86 FR 48897) to 
better coordinate with the DDP. Both donation programs provide for 
reimbursement of certain costs for donations of milk and dairy products 
and help reduce food waste.
    The DDP and the 2021 amendments to MDRP were set to expire 
September 1, 2023. However, AMS determined to retain both programs as 
established and amended and to further amend certain provisions of both 
parts. The final rule of August 25, 2023, made further amendments to 
both parts and removed expiration of the DDP provisions, but failed to 
remove expiration of the 2021 amendments to the MDRP. This document 
corrects that oversight.
